A de facto two-tier championship?

(Oldest Posts First)

As the last two provincial QFs will be played next week, no county football team has yet defeated a side from a higher League division, though Westmeath are strongly fancied to defeat Offaly. With only three counties from the lower divisions making the provincial semis, do we effectively have a two-tier championship already?

Division One: 7 qualified (Cavan v Monaghan next week)
Division Two: 6 (Derry and Fermanagh eliminated by D1 sides)
Division Three: 1 or 2 (Tipp bye to semis, Offaly face Westmeath.)
Division Four: 1 or 2 (Leitrim defeating London, Westmeath v Offaly).
